Smart Manufacturing for All

In this conversation, we talked about democratizing smart manufacturing, the history and ambition of CESMII (2016-), bridging the skills gap in small and medium enterprises which constitute 98% of manufacturing. We discuss how the integration of advanced sensors, data, platforms and controls to radically impact manufacturing performance. We then have the hard discussion of why the US is (arguably) a laggard? John shares the 7 characteristics of future-proofing (interoperability, openness, sustainability, security, etc.). We hear about two coming initiatives: Smart Manufacturing Executive Council & Smart Manufacturing Innovation Platform. We then turn to the future outlook over the next decade.

Aerospace Affinity Group

This Affinity Group will concentrate on systems and electronic assemblies’ standards across multiple Aerospace/Defense platforms and utilization of SM to accelerate energy efficiencies, productivities and reduce waste throughout the manufacturing stream. These efforts will be critical elements of SM technologies such as smart sensors, data analytics, machine learning, connectivity, cybersecurity, digital engineering, in-process digital monitoring, and process control.
